Materials and Craftsmanship
The necklaces described in the provided sources are primarily constructed using gold-filled and 14k gold materials. Malabella Jewels specifies gold-plated and CZ initial charms alongside hand-wrapped 14k gold-filled gemstones. Babygold exclusively utilizes 14k solid gold, emphasizing the durability and lasting quality of their pieces. Gold-filled materials offer a cost-effective alternative to solid gold, providing a durable and tarnish-resistant finish. Sterling silver options, often with an 18k gold finish, are also available, as offered by Caitlyn Minimalist.
The gemstones themselves are consistently described as “real gemstones,” explicitly differentiating them from cubic zirconia. This emphasis on genuine gemstones underscores the value and authenticity of the jewelry. The sources consistently highlight hypoallergenic and lead-free materials, catering to sensitive skin and ensuring a comfortable wearing experience.

Care and Maintenance
While the sources do not provide detailed care instructions, the materials used suggest certain best practices. Gold-filled and solid gold pieces can be cleaned with a soft cloth and mild soap and water. Avoid harsh chemicals and abrasive cleaners, which could damage the finish. Gemstones should also be handled with care, avoiding impacts that could cause chipping or scratching. Regular cleaning will help maintain the brilliance and luster of both the metal and the gemstones.
